Filip Krajinovic vs Matteo Berrettini. Prediction and Betting Tips for ATP London (June 19, 2022).

Command Analysis

Filip Krajinovic has been very inconsistent this season, and this is his first final in 2022. On his way to the final, the Serbian tennis player outplayed Jenson Brooksby (6-4, 6-3), Sam Querrey (4-6, 6-3, 6-4), Ryan Peniston (4-6, 6-3, 6-3), and Marin Cilic (6-3, 6-3). Krajinovic's performance in the semifinal match against Cilic was very impressive.

Last week, Matteo Berrettini won the Stuttgart Open. In the final match, he defeated Andy Murray in three sets (6-4, 5-7, 6-3). Berrettini's momentum carried him all the way to the final of the Queen's Club Championships, despite many expecting him to take it easy in London. The Italian won three matches here in straight sets. In the Round of 16, he faced a difficult match with Denis Kudla, but triumphed in the third decisive set (3-6, 7-6, 6-4).
